Specializations
Respiratory Viral Infections
The investigator specializes in studying immune responses to respiratory syncytial virus (RSV) infections, with particular focus on vulnerable populations.
- RSV vaccine immunology
- Transplant recipient immunity
- Adult respiratory infections
Primary research focus includes evaluating immune responses in organ transplant recipients and older adults.
Transplant Medicine
Conducts specialized research in solid organ transplant recipients, particularly focusing on lung and kidney transplant patients.
- Post-transplant viral immunity
- Immunological responses
- Preventive vaccination
Investigates protective immune strategies for transplant recipients at increased risk of respiratory infections.
Vaccine Co-administration
Explores the effectiveness of concurrent vaccination strategies, particularly studying RSV and COVID-19 vaccine interactions.
- Vaccine immunogenicity
- Combined vaccination safety
- Adult immune responses
Studies focus on optimal vaccination approaches for older adults against multiple respiratory pathogens.
